Free QuoteThe Indonesian government has revealed a new initiative aiming to deploy 100 GW of solar. The distributed solar for energy self-sufficiency program encompasses 80 GW of solar that will be deployed as 1 MW solar arrays with 4 MWh of accompanying battery energy storage systems (BESS).
That proposed site was intended to encompass an integrated solar PV power plant located across the Batam, Bintan, and Karimun regions of Indonesia with a generation capacity targeted at 1GW.
Currently operational projects include a modest government-backed pilot scheme generating just 5MW announced back in March 2022. Energy storage technology plays an essential role as Indonesia transitions toward greater reliance on intermittent renewables like solar and wind.
The initiative is still under development, with Indonesia's Ministry of Energy and Mineral Resources, Coordinating Ministry of Economic Affairs and Coordinating Ministry of Food responsible for its preparation. IESR has estimated Indonesia has a potential solar energy capacity ranging from 3,300 GW to 20,000 GW.
Fabby Tumiwa, Chief Executive Officer of the Jakarta-based Institute for Essential Services Reform (IESR), told pv magazine that solar-plus-BESS generates cheaper electricity than the diesel power plants that power villages and remote islands in Indonesia.
